HUNTSMAN TO SHOWCASE HOW ITS TPU CAN HELP SHAPE THE WORLD AT NPE 2012<br />
Booth 37013, 1-5 April 2012, Orange County Convention Center, Orlando, Florida<br />
The Woodlands, TX – Thermoplastic polyurethanes (TPUs) from <strong>Huntsman</strong> offer many possibilities<br />
for meeting the manufacturing challenges of a fast-changing world, and at this year’s NPE exhibition,<br />
representatives from the company’s TPU business will showcase an interesting combination of new<br />
and established products.<br />
Well-known for their versatility, <strong>Huntsman</strong>’s wide range of specialty TPU resins can improve the<br />
production and enrich the performance of different products including screens, seals, films and<br />
footwear. At NPE, emphasis will be placed on core products that can help shape and influence items<br />
used around the world, everyday, including:<br />
• AVALON ® AHT – a new line of transparent aromatic TPUs with enhanced UV resistance for<br />
injection molding applications. Typically used in the footwear industry, AVALON ® TPUs afford<br />
manufacturers the freedom to make tough, yet comfortable shoes and boots in a variety of<br />
designs and colors. Products from the AVALON ® ABR range will also be on display. These TPUs<br />
are abrasion resistant and designed specifically for footwear applications, such as cleats, soccer<br />
plates and top pieces.<br />
• <strong>Huntsman</strong> will also launch IROGRAN ® CA117-200 at NPE 2012. This new TPU resin, for use in<br />
extruded adhesive films, is easy to process, has a low melting point, crystallizes quickly and has<br />
good green strength.<br />
Other thermoplastic solutions featured will include:<br />
• IROGRAN ® A 95 BK 4922 – a new high performance polycarbonate-based TPU that can be<br />
injection molded. This product offers a good balance between oil and hydrolysis resistance in high<br />
temperature environments.<br />
• IROGRAN ® A 92 K 5031 DP – a TPU that can provide a broader operating temperature range<br />
than standard grades and performs well in industrial applications, where compromise is not an<br />
option. Formulated with the needs of modern manufacturing in mind, IROGRAN ® A 92 K 5031 DP<br />
can be extruded or injection molded to create components for heavy-duty engineering equipment,<br />
engines and hydraulic systems, where working conditions may reach up to 130°C or drop as low<br />
as -40°C.
<strong>News</strong> <strong>Release</strong><br />
• IROGRAN ® A 95 K 4977 – an easy to process polycaprolactone-based TPU that offers an<br />
excellent compression set at elevated temperatures and therefore performs well in hydraulic seal<br />
applications.<br />
• And KRYSTALGRAN ® resins – a range of aliphatic solutions used to create protective films for<br />
non-optical applications. KRYSTALGRAN ® resins were first developed for use in the automotive<br />
industry. Converted by film producers into a transparent, UV-resistant sheet, they can be applied<br />
to the bodywork of a car to help protect it from chips and scratches caused by stones, gravel and<br />
grit. Now, the technology is also finding application in the electronics sector, where it has come to<br />
the attention of manufacturers who want to safeguard the screens of portable consumer devices,<br />
such as tablet personal computers and smart phones.<br />

About <strong>Huntsman</strong>: <br />
<strong>Huntsman</strong> is a global manufacturer and marketer of differentiated chemicals. Our operating companies manufacture<br />
products for a variety of global industries, including chemicals, plastics, automotive, aviation, textiles, footwear, paints and<br />
coatings, construction, technology, agriculture, health care, detergent, personal care, furniture, appliances and packaging.<br />
Originally known for pioneering innovations in packaging and, later, for rapid and integrated growth in petrochemicals,<br />
<strong>Huntsman</strong> has approximately 12,000 employees and operates from multiple locations worldwide. The Company had 2011<br />
revenues of over $11 billion. For more information about <strong>Huntsman</strong>, please visit the company's website at<br />
www.huntsman.com. <br />
